04/02/2025 (Agence Europe) – Annual inflation in the euro area is estimated at 2.5% in January, compared with 2.4% in December 2024, according to a flash estimate published by the Statistical Office of the European Union (Eurostat) on Monday 3 February. The highest rates were observed in Croatia (5.0%), Belgium (4.4%) and Slovakia (4.1%), while the lowest were in Ireland (1.5%), Finland (1.6%), Italy and Malta (both 1.7%). Price rises were moderate in France (1.8%) and sustained in Germany (2.8%) and Spain (2.9%). In terms of the main components of inflation, services is expected to see the highest rate (3.9%, compared with 4.0% in December), followed by food, alcohol and tobacco (2.3%, compared with 2.6% in December), energy (1.8%, compared with 0.1% in December) and non-energy industrial goods (0.5%, stable compared with December).
